A new category in skincare
Conventional skincare is produced for long shelf life, often sitting for years before reaching the consumer. This requires preservatives and stabilizers that can interfere with the skin’s natural ecosystem. Skinome is different:
- Freshness – products are made in small batches and should be kept cold.
- Microbiome protection – every formula is designed to strengthen the skin’s microbiome and barrier.
- No unnecessary additives – Skinome’s freshly produced products do not contain preservatives, perfume, suspected hormone-disrupting ingredients, or other unnecessary additives.
- Nordic science – combining decades of dermatology research with Scandinavian minimalism.
This approach makes Skinome not just another skincare brand, but a new category: fresh skincare.
Skinome’s founder: Dr. Johanna Gillbro
Behind Skinome stands Dr. Johanna Gillbro, skin scientists with more than 20 years of experience in dermatology research. She is internationally recognized for her work on pigmentation, skin biology, and the microbiome, and is the author of the bestselling book in Sweden, The Scandinavian Skincare Bible.
Johanna’s own personal journey, being diagnosed with vitiligo as a child, sparked a lifelong dedication to skin science. With Skinome, she translates research into formulations that respect the skin as a living organ.
Skinome’s philosophy: Less but better
Skinome rejects the industry’s complexity and overload of products. Instead, the brand develops a curated range of essentials that meet the skin’s real needs: hydration, nourishment, and microbiome support.
Key products available in the Netherlands include:
- Probiotic Concentrate – a serum enriched with live probiotics to balance the skin microbiome.
- Light Emulsions & Rich Emulsion – moisturizers designed to strengthen the skin barrier, tailored to different skin needs.
- Retinal Concentrate – a water-free, activation-step concentrate featuring retinal (0.1%), vitamin C, niacinamide, acetylglucosamine and prebiotics. Design to be mixed with moisturizer at application, it provides for a fresh dose every time for maximum impact.
All products are stored chilled before delivery, with clear instructions for storage and use — making the experience of skincare closer to fresh food than cosmetics.
